MEDIUM:1 photographic print. CREATED/PUBLISHED:1921. NOTES: Nita Naldi a Famous Players-Lasky (Paramount) star, shown here in a scene with Houdini, was cast as the villainous femme fatale. Her dangerous allure was also emphasized in 1922 when she played opposite Rudolph Valentino in "Blood and sand." Houdini''s love interest in "The man from beyond," was Jane Connelly, a more ethereal presence, described in advertising copy as "a remarkable psychic type."
